2012-05944 In the Matter of Joanna Ruskin, respondent, v Jeffrey Stolpere, appellant. (Docket No. F-10985/10)
| D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ION |
Appeal by Jeffrey Stolpere from an order of the Family Court, Westchester County, dated May 4, 2010.
On the Court's own motion, it is
ORDERED that the appeal is dismissed, without costs or disbursements, as no appeal lies from an order of a support magistrate before objections have been reviewed by a judge of the Family Court (see Family Ct Act § 439[e]).
DICKERSON, J.P., BELEN, AUSTIN and COHEN, JJ., concur.
